If you are hankering to give the game a shot yourself, the Resident Evil 5 demo is up now for download on Xbox Live for those Xbox 360 owners who are Gold members. If you only have an Xbox Live Silver Membership you will have to wait a week before you can get your hands on the demo.

As for you PlayStation 3 folks, you’ll have to wait until February 2nd before you can get your shaking-from-anticipation-and-jealousy hands on the demo. But don’t hate on Capcom too much for leaving you out in the cold, they are so intent on getting the demo out that they will actually be releasing it on a MONDAY rather than the typical PSN release of Thursday.

The demo (which is 478 MB) will allow you to play through two full levels from the game and is playable in both single-player and multiplayer co-op so that you can go through the demo with a buddy. You can even go to xbox.com and add the demo to your download queue from your computer if you are so inclined (if you’re at work, school, or the like), which I must say is a feature that I didn’t know existed.
